International Activist, Poet, and Elementary Teacher Cesar Cruz was fired Monday at Downer Elementary School. The firing occured after an article was published that documented Cesar's organizing of a 70 mile march on Sacramento by students and parents to protest budget cuts at their 99% people of color school, as well as the presence of the nearby prison and oil refinery. (Un) Coincidentally, Cesar had also recently aided the community in their demands for a new school and site-based manage...
